Waterworks; contaminants; notification to customers. Requires a waterworks owner that receives a finished water test result from a U.S. Environmental Protection Agency-approved method for drinking water for any PFAS chemical subject to a PFAS advisory and such result that exceeds the notification concentration, as defined in the bill, to (i) report such result to the Department of Health, (ii) provide public notice in the required consumer confidence report provided to the waterworks owner's customers and by posting on the waterworks owner's website, and (iii) provide such additional public notice as the Department may require on a case-by-case basis under applicable regulations.
